Gotts roadside was one of the popular places that popped up when we were looking for lunch options in the area. And to an extent it does live up to the hype! They have a great menu with some really good vegetarian options. What we got: Tofu sandwich, garlic fries, avocado tacos and caramelized pineapple shake. The caramelized pineapple shake was really good and perfect for a hot afternoon. The tacos were my favorite from the things we tried. Definitely worth a visit.

These burgers are 5 napkin burgers, meaning they are good as HECK! I had the cheeseburger which was cooked to perfection and seasoned so well. I also ordered the garlics fries and onion rings. Let’s start with the garlic fries. They were so delicious and hot/ fresh. They tasted so good you didn’t even need ketchup. The onion rings where battered so right and had so much flavor I wanted more! I actually made my own BBQ burger by adding the onion rings and bbq sauce. It was so good. Customer service was good but the wait for the food took a little longer than expected. However I didn’t take any stars away because of it since the food was good. Can’t wait to go back and try some different menu items.

The fried cauliflower is awesome! Perfectly battered and fried, don’t sleep on this tasty appetizer. Burgers are good, meat is naturally raised and you can taste the difference. Fish tacos are okay, good portion, just not too flavorful. Staff is friendly and the place is clean.
